#855876 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#855876 is composed of 52.2% red, 34.5%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 33.8% magenta, 11.3%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 320 degrees, a saturation of 20.4% and a lightness of 43.3%. #855876 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b0ec with #0b0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

Shades and Tints of #855876

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030203 is the darkest color, while #f9f6f8 is the lightest one.
